Score 95/100 · Drink 2027-2055, William Kelley, Wine Advocate, Aug 2021

A highlight this year is the 2019 Chablis Grand Cru Valmur, a full-bodied, deep and layered wine evocative of citrus oil, clear honey, blanched almonds, beeswax and iodine. Satiny-textured and concentrated, with racy acids and a long, electric finish, it's another immensely promising wine from Fèvre that should be forgotten in the cellar.

Score 17/20 · Drink 2024-2032, Julia Harding MW, jancisrobinson.com, Dec 2020

60–70% fermented in French oak barrels (aged 6 years on average). The remainder is vinified in small stainless-steel vats. Aged 14–15 months, of which 5 to 6 months on fine lees in French oak barrels for 60 to 70% of the harvest. The end of maturation occurs in small stainless-steel vats. Tank sample. Deep and gently creamy but not obviously oaky. Some notes of ripe green fruits and citrus, even a touch of orange. Generous, rounded, creamy in the mouth with a fine line of citrus giving persistence. (JH)
